The Product Management function drives company’s revenue growth, profit margin, and market share through market-driven strategies, new and enhanced products, and effective execution.

The Director of Product Management – Product Stewardship leads the strategy, development, and execution of global product stewardship programs to ensure products meet regulatory, safety, environmental, and sustainability standards throughout their lifecycle. This role partners cross-functionally with Product Management, R&D, Operations, Regulatory Affairs, and Sustainability teams to drive compliance, reduce risk, and enhance the company’s environmental and social responsibility footprint.

Key Responsibilities

Strategic Leadership

  • Develop and execute a comprehensive product stewardship strategy aligned with corporate sustainability goals and global compliance requirements.
  • Lead initiatives to ensure compliance with product-related regulations (e.g., REACH, RoHS, TSCA, Prop 65, WEEE, GHS, PFAS restrictions, etc.).
  • Represent Product Stewardship in strategic planning and new product development processes to ensure proactive compliance and design-for-sustainability.

Product Lifecycle Management

  • Oversee product compliance and stewardship across the entire lifecycle—from material sourcing and manufacturing to end-of-life management.
  • Collaborate with product managers and engineers to integrate environmental and safety considerations into product design and portfolio decisions.
  • Drive product data management systems for regulatory and sustainability reporting.

Cross-functional Collaboration

  • Partner with global regulatory, EHS, legal, and supply chain teams to ensure adherence to applicable standards and to respond to emerging regulatory trends.
  • Support customers and sales teams with accurate product compliance documentation and sustainability disclosures (e.g., SCIP, SDS, EPDs).
  • Engage with industry associations, NGOs, and government agencies to stay ahead of emerging requirements and best practices.
